Floating Screwdriver from Phillips

From the company that invented a better screw comes a better screwdriver. "Gear and Gadgets" from our June 27, 2008, CW Reckonings
by Andrew Burton
Floating Screwdriver from Phillips
Courtesy Phillips
When you drop this screwdriver in the drink, you won't need scuba equipment to retrieve it.

It's been 75 years since Henry Phillips invented his famous screw head. Now the company is reinventing itself and has introduced a floating version of its famous screwdriver. We've all lost tools overboard so this is a welcome development. The hardened stainless steel shaft will resist rust, and the new Anti cam-out ribs on the bit help keep it in the screw head. The well thought out grip lets you get plenty of leverage on those hard-to-budge screws.
